Statoil Award Semi Submersible Engineering Contract to Helix Energy Solutions

2010.04.15 - Contracts

Helix Energy Solutions Group has been awarded a Front End Engineering and Design (FEED) contract by Norwegian producer Statoil to assist in the development of its forthcoming “Category B” semi-submersible well intervention vessel.

The vessel will be designed for year round well intervention operations by Statoil, providing a full range of through riser heavy well intervention and light drilling techniques, including TTRD (Through Tubular Rotary Drilling), wireline, coil tubing, pumping and cementing.

The design of the Category B service unit will be based on Helix ESG’s Q4000 semi-submersible platform operating in the Gulf of Mexico.

Scott Cormack, business development manager of Helix Well Ops UK in Aberdeen, said:  “Statoil’s decision to award Helix this contract reinforces our reputation as leading experts on well intervention processes and in the management and deployment of specialist vessels and personnel.”

Helix ESG operates a fleet of specialist vessels and mobile equipment which is used to improve production output in subsea oil and gas fields and in construction, intervention and decommissioning services.

In addition to the Q4000, Helix’s intervention fleet includes the light intervention and diving vessels Seawell and Well Enhancer, and operates the MSV Normand Clough via CloughHelix JV.

ClampOn awarded Tampen Link delivery of subsea Leak Monitors

ClampOn has been awarded a contract for delivery of five subsea ClampOn DSP Leak Monitors to the Tampen Link project in the Norwegian sector in the North Sea (Sept 07). ClampOn will supply its ultrasonic non-intrusive acoustic Leak Monitors to Technip Norge AS on behalf of Statoil. The Leak Monitors will be retrofitted on two 20” gas valves on the seabed to verify/disprove through-valve gas leakage. These valves are currently open and they will be shut to close off the bypass alternative.
